Qısa məlumat

The article is devoted to the problem of development and application of information technologies in the strategic management of industrial enterprises under uncertainty based on mathematical modeling. The purpose of the article is to develop tools that support decision-making when choosing strategic guidelines for the development of enterprises using economic and mathematical methods. The study of the system of strategic management of industrial enterprises, which has the property of development, based on the application of the methodology of system analysis. A model of the strategic management process in the form of a logical structure containing a combined decision-making procedure for solving problems, ranging from the study of the environment and the development of the mission, and ending with the creation of economic and mathematical tools and its use to evaluate decisions. The economic and mathematical tools to support decision-making on the strategic guidelines for the development of industrial enterprises in the conditions of stochastic uncertainty. As the characteristics of the cost-effectiveness of strategies selected measure of profitability. The toolkit is created in the class of simulation models and allows you to reproduce the dynamics of enterprise profits and capital costs by the method of statistical tests, as well as to predict on this basis the profitability of various options of strategic guidelines for the operation of the enterprise. The constructed economic and mathematical models are algorithmized and implemented in a software product. The article demonstrates the work of the software product in the course of simulation experiments and their processing in the evaluation of the selected strategic benchmark in terms of profitability. The built model tools are designed for use in industrial enterprises to support strategic decisions.
